St Martin’s Church and the Royal School of Church Music (RSCM) invite experienced choral singers to come and sing a Choral Evensong that commemorates the anniversaries of William Byrd and Thomas Weelkes, who both died in 1623. Distinguished choral conductor Paul Trepte (formerly Director of Music at Ely Cathedral) will guide the ‘Come and Sing’ Choir to create an Evensong service that would have been familiar to a Worcester congregation in the years leading up to the English Civil War. Singers are asked to book their place online stmartinsevensong.eventbrite.co.uk, places are free, but donations are welcomed. Everyone is welcome to join the congregation for the service at 6pm – a traditional cathedral-style Choral Evensong with congregational hymns and readings from the King James Bible, congregation do not need to book.
